Facility Inspections
While this nursing home's overall grade was decent, it really excelled in the category of inspections. In fact, we awarded it a grade of A for that category, which is one of our highest scores. Inspection ratings account for several factors found on a nursing home's inspection report. One of the most important criteria we rely on is the quantity and severity of deficiencies. Nursing homes with better grades in this category tend to have few severe deficiencies. Although this nursing home had a few deficiencies on its report, none of them were serious based on CMS' scale. A couple of minor deficiencies shouldn't stop you from considering a nursing home.

This indicates the percentage of long-term care patients who developed new or worsened pressure ulcers . We consider this statistic when determining both nursing and long-term care grades.

This tells you the percentage of residents who have had a major fall. Falls resulting in major injury are considered to be an indicator of nursing care . Falls leading to injury are often caused by lower quality nursing care.

This metric indicates the percentage of long-term patients that are prescribed antipsychotic drugs. Excessive reliance on these medications may mean that a nursing home is using these medications to control patient behavior in scenarios where such medications aren't medically indicated. Nevertheless, some facilities need to rely more on these drugs due to having more residents suffering from dementia.
